Variable length coding method and variable length decoding method

1. A method for coding quantized coefficients of a block image, the method comprising:
scanning a two-dimensional array of quantized coefficients into scanned quantized coefficients, wherein said scanning is performed from a low frequency component toward a high frequency component;
converting the scanned quantized coefficients into a run value and a level value, the run value indicating the number of continuous quantized coefficients, each having a zero value, and the level value indicating a value of a quantized coefficient having a non-zero value;
coding the run value; and
coding the level value;
wherein the coding of the run value is performed, from a high frequency component toward a low frequency component, in accordance with information that represents a total number of uncoded quantized coefficients which have not been coded.
